• 17-10-2021, 20:14:24
    #1
    Merhaba Arkadaşlar,

    Farklı yazılar için farklı single.php kullanmak istiyorum bunu nasıl yapabilirim ?

    Genelde farklı kategoriler için farklı single.php kullanılıyor ama yazılar için farklı single.php kullanım örneği bulamadım.
  • 17-10-2021, 20:16:29
    #2
    Single php içerisine bir if şartı koyulup yazı öyle olursa şu kodlarla oluştur böyle olursa bu kodlarla oluştur denilebilir.
  • 17-10-2021, 20:20:41
    #3
    Wordpress kategori id lerine göre if şartı koyup, yazının kategorisine göre ayrı single.php çalıştırabilirsin.
  • 17-10-2021, 20:22:49
    #4
    onurnet adlı üyeden alıntı: mesajı görüntüle
    Single php içerisine bir if şartı koyulup yazı öyle olursa şu kodlarla oluştur böyle olursa bu kodlarla oluştur denilebilir.
    <?php
    $post = $wp_query->post;
    if ( in_category('3') ) {
     include(TEMPLATEPATH . '/single-list.php'); }
     else { include(TEMPLATEPATH . '/single-blog.php');
    }
    ?>
    Örnek kodu nasıl güncellemem gerek ?



    DoganKartal adlı üyeden alıntı: mesajı görüntüle
    Wordpress kategori id lerine göre if şartı koyup, yazının kategorisine göre ayrı single.php çalıştırabilirsin.
    Bunları zaten biliyorum. Ancak ben kategoriye göre değil yazıya göre single.php istiyorum.
  • 17-10-2021, 20:27:32
    #5
    Hocam onun için mesela yazı eklerken bir koşul eklenen gerek mantıken. Mesela soru olabilir ya da cevap olabilir. Bunun içeriğini girerken bile farklı koşul eklemen gerek. Bende bir tema var soru cevap anket hepsinin farklı template-yazisekli gibi dosyaları var.
    Biraz anlam bozukluğu oldu.